1 in 4 people in the US have a treatable mental health condition, but most providers don't accept insurance, making therapy too expensive for most people. Headway’s mission is to fix this by building a new mental healthcare system everyone can access. We started by solving the biggest barrier to care: insurance. The admin work - credentialing, claims, payment reconciliation - is a nightmare. We've automated that.

But we're going further. Over 75,000 providers across all 50 states run their practice on our software, serving over 1 million patients. We are building the best tools for therapists to run their entire practice, reimagining the experience of finding a therapist, and investing in the platform foundations to enable this at scale. We aren't just a billing layer; we are becoming the platform where care actually happens.

About the Team & Role

Not every patient finds Headway through a Google search. Millions discover us through their employer's Employee Assistance Program (EAP), a health system referral, or a payer's provider directory. These partnership-driven channels are among Headway's fastest-growing, and they need a designer who can make the handoff from a third party into care feel seamless, trustworthy, and human.

As a Senior Product Designer on the Patient team, you'll own the patient experience across our three partnership channels: Health Systems, EAP, and Payer Partnerships. Your work spans the full range, from inventing new products from scratch to scaling proven ones across new partners and segments. You'll be the only designer in the room for these channels, shaping what gets built, not just how it looks. You'll present prototypes directly in partner meetings that influence multi-million-dollar relationships.

You'll partner closely with a Staff PM, engineering, and cross-functional teams including Payer Relations, Health System BD, and Ops. You'll report to the Director of Product Design for Patient.

We're building an AI-first design team at Headway. Designers use AI tools like Claude, Cursor, and MagicPatterns to prototype and stay involved through launch and iteration directly in code. You'll start in planning mode, using Claude.ai to clarify the problem space and test assumptions. You'll prototype with Claude Code/Cursor and MagicPatterns to build and iterate on flows, letting AI generate the pixels and code while you define the right patterns, behaviors, and quality. We're looking for designers who are already working this way and see AI as a primary part of their workflow.

What You'll Own

  • Health Systems. Design and scale the referral-to-booking experience for patients arriving through health system partners. This includes our Booking Assistant (BA) tool, referrer-facing dashboards, and new intake flows as we expand to more health systems.

  • EAP. Design experiences for patients accessing care through employer EAP benefits. This includes onboarding flows for new payer EAP programs, a major experience redesign to help patients take advantage of free EAP sessions, and early-stage product exploration.

  • Payer Partnerships. Create co-branded patient journeys and landing pages, improve provider directory discoverability, and optimize conversion for patients arriving through payer channels.

  • Experimentation. Run sustained, multi-sprint experiments to close the conversion gap between partnership-sourced and organic patients.

You'd be a great fit if...

  • You've designed consumer experiences within B2B2C or platform constraints. You know how to make a third-party handoff feel native and trustworthy.

  • You bring product strategy instinct, not just design craft. You proactively shape what to build based on customer insights, not just execute what PM hands you.

  • You're fluent in experimentation. You've run multi-sprint experiment arcs with real conversion and retention metrics, and you treat negative results as learning.

  • You thrive in ambiguity. "Figure out what to build" energizes you more than "make this look better."

  • You communicate design decisions to non-design stakeholders (BD, Ops, partner teams) with ease, and you've used prototypes as persuasion tools.

  • You're excited to work in an AI-native design environment. Our team prototypes in MagicPatterns, Cursor, and Claude Code, with working demos as the primary artifact.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
